Cardinals in the Lamplight (on Slate)

Large 10″T x 20″W Slate with 2 Cardinals in a winter setting of pine and snow along with a glowing brass lamp post light and greetings sign. Shutters with handles are painted along each side of the slate as if peering through a window. ….A warm Welcome plaque. (Wire can be added for hanging, if desired.)

COST: $60

~ Jingle Bells ~
Intermediate Class: November 2008

Brass, Bronze and Silver Bells along with Red Ribbon were painted on a wood-grain background. After the painting was done, we added real bells to our plaque. They look Great!
